Maḩal-e Shahōnak
Maḩal-e Shahōnak is a locality in Khwahan District, Badakhshan Province and has an elevation of 1,016 metres. Maḩal-e Shahōnak is situated nearby to the locality Maḩal-e Kamar, as well as near the village Kisht.| Tap on a place to explore it |
